Prediabetes: moving away from a glucocentric definition
The Lancet Diabetes & Endocrinology ( IF 44.0 ) Pub Date : 2017-08-03 , DOI: 10.1016/s2213-8587(17)30234-6
Prashanth R J Vas , K George Alberti , Michael E Edmonds

Prediabetes (or intermediate hyperglycaemia) is defined as a state in which glycaemic variables are higher than normal, lower than the threshold for diabetes, but have reached a level shown to pose an increased risk of developing diabetes in the future.1 In 2012, Tabák and colleagues1 argued that the definition of prediabetes should no longer be glucocentric. Prediabetes is associated with generalised microvascular dysfunction and evidence has increasingly shown that patients with prediabetes have microvascular sequelae representing end-organ damage typical of diabetes.
